Chains Due 12/10

Mr. Robert collects Isabel and Ruth on the day of Miss Mary's funeral. Why aren't the girls allowed to take personal items with them? Explain the symbolism of the seeds that Isabel hides in her pockets.

Boy in the Striped Pajamas Due 12/10

Bruno asks his father about the people outside their house at Auschwitz.His father answers, "They're not people at all Bruno." (p. 53) Discuss the horror of this attitude. How does his father's statement make Bruno more curious about Out-With?

Hunger Games Due 12/10

What do you think is the cruelest part of the "Hunger Games?" What kind of people would devise this spectacle for the entertainment of their populace? Can you see parallels between these Games and the society that condones them, and other events and cultures in the history of the world?

Tuck Everlasting Due 12/10

What is Winnie's life like at home? How does this influence her entering the woods? This should be at least a paragraph.
